Geneva man arrested after investigation into drug sales

Police report the arrest of a Geneva man for selling crack cocaine.

According to a news release, the Canandaigua Police Department arrested Willie H. Spann, 54, of Geneva for criminal sale of a controlled substance.


The arrest of Spann is a result of a co-investigation with the assistance of the Geneva Police Department alleging that he stole crack cocaine while in the city of Canandaigua.

Spann is pending arraignment at the Ontario County Jail.
